Cost Analysis of Owning Electric Utility Vehicles vs. Traditional Models
Electric utility vehicles (EUVs) are gaining traction as a sustainable alternative in the transportation industry. Cost analysis reveals compelling benefits when comparing EUVs to traditional models. A recent study indicates that maintenance costs for EUVs are about 30% lower due to fewer moving parts. These vehicles are also equipped with regenerative braking systems, which enhance efficiency and extend vehicle life.
However, the initial purchase price of electric utility vehicles can deter potential buyers. Research by the U.S. Department of Energy shows that the average upfront cost of an electric vehicle is still higher than that of gasoline counterparts, often by 20-30%. Yet, tax incentives and rebates can reduce this gap significantly. Additionally, the total cost of ownership often favors EUVs in the long run, especially as electricity prices remain stable compared to fluctuating fuel costs.
Charging infrastructure remains a challenge in many areas. Some regions lack adequate access to charging stations, which can lead to range anxiety. A survey conducted by the Electric Auto Association found that 40% of consumers hesitate due to these concerns. Addressing these issues is crucial for broader adoption. While EUVs promise a cleaner future, potential buyers must weigh both the financial and logistical aspects carefully.
Future Trends in Electric Utility Vehicle Technology and Sustainability
The electric utility vehicle market is rapidly evolving. Industry reports show a projected growth rate of over 20% annually in the electric utility segment. This trend stems from increasing demands for sustainable solutions in transportation and logistics.
Future trends indicate that innovative battery technologies will lead the charge. Solid-state batteries promise longer life and faster charging. They could boost vehicle ranges, making them more appealing. Additionally, integration of smart technologies is a key focus. It allows for real-time monitoring and improved efficiency. Companies are exploring vehicle-to-grid (V2G) technology. This enables vehicles to not only consume energy but also supply it back to the grid.
